Onboarding note — Quiet Room, Level 6. The top floor of the Ashbourne Point building includes a quiet room intended for rest, prayer, or focused decompression. Reception staff should know its location when directing visitors or new starters: turn left from the lift lobby, past the plant wall, second door. No meetings, calls, or food inside. Lights are motion-activated and the room holds two people maximum. The door stays locked at all times and opens with the code below.

badge for yahag-yajep: bdg-N-77

Handover Note — From Director M. Quennel to Director S. Abayo

Re: Legacy customer price increase, Veltrix Platform

The 9% uplift for pre-2019 contracts is approved and scheduled in two waves. Wave one letters go out at month end; wave two follows sixty days later. Churn modeling suggests losses under 4%, concentrated in the Darnley branch accounts. Retention offers are pre-approved up to 5% off. Heads of department should hold messaging until both waves complete. Context on why timing matters is recorded below.

internal memo for kawip-hadug: Headcount on the Wenwyn team goes from 7 to 140 by the end of January. Gross margin on Wenwyn came in at 20 percent against a plan of 15 percent.

## Further reading

The Brindlevault retention sweeper runs nightly and hard-deletes records past their tenant's retention window. Heads up for support: deletions are final — there's no undelete, and "but the customer asked nicely" doesn't change that. If a tenant disputes a deletion, check the sweeper audit log first; it records what was removed and under which policy. Legal holds pause sweeping per-tenant. How to read the audit log and request a hold is covered on the internal page here.

wiki page, fahaf-yagag: https://confluence.qorvellabs.internal/pages/display/pages/display

Handover for new starters — Pell & Varden IT. After-hours server room access: door stays locked 19:00–07:00 and weekends. Log every visit in the ops book on the shelf inside, even a two-minute check. No food, no propping the door. Aircon alarm sounds if it's open more than ten minutes — just close it. Out-of-hours issues go to the duty engineer first, not facilities. The keypad by the inner door takes the code below.

staff pass of kawip-hawef = bdg-QLP-2